What This Means (2025 FDD)
According to Card My Yard's 2025 Franchise Disclosure Document, the net change in the number of total outlets during 2024 was an increase of 11. This is based on the total number of outlets at the start of the year being 534 and the total at the end of the year being 545.
Specifically, the number of franchised outlets increased from 532 at the beginning of 2024 to 543 by the end of the year, representing a net increase of 11 franchised locations. The number of company-owned outlets remained constant at 2 throughout 2024.
